The Wheel of Time Season 2 Ending Explained: Will Ishamael Really Dead?

Towards the end of The Wheel of Time Season 2, most of the story’s plots come together and show our protagonists in an impressive battle. Egwene, for example, gains her freedom after torturing Renna. And, although her captor begs for mercy, the young woman ends up with her at the top of the tower. Immediately, Rand al’Thor reunites with the girl, only to be overtaken by Ishamael. He makes it clear that he is far more powerful than either of them or gives Rand one last chance to become the Dragon in the Dark. On the other hand, Mat takes the Horn, while Perrin continues the fight against his enemies. Unfortunately, it ends with the wolf Hopper dying at the hands of Geofram Bornhald. Perrin then murders the guy in retaliation. Finding himself surrounded by Seanchan warriors, Mat is forced to blow the Horn and summon his heroes. In this way, he remembers that it is something he has done previously in his past lives. Back at the tower, Mat intends to attack Ishamael with a dagger. However, it was an illusion on the part of the villain, and it was Rand who was injured.

The Prophecy and the Encounter at Falme?

It all started three thousand years ago, when Lews Therin, Lanfear, and Ishamael were close friends. However, their friendship fell apart when Lanfear and Ishamael turned to the Dark Side. Lews Therin resisted and managed to trap Ishamael in a state of consciousness but without mobility. Three millennia later, Rand the Dragon Reborn inadvertently freed him. The prophecy about Rand predicts that he will be announced to the world in the city of Falme after the city is saved from great danger. During the second season of The Wheel of Time, the friends are reunited in Falme, but a “Great Danger” looms over the city in the form of the Children of Light, who plan to attack the Seanchan. Everyone has their reasons for being there, and their stories are interconnected. They must face not only the fanatical humans but also the dark forces of Ishamael to protect themselves and prevent the breaking of the Wheel.

Mat and Perrin’s Awakening?

This season of The Wheel of Time witnesses the growth and maturation of the characters, especially Mat and Perrin. Perrin ultimately discovers that his ability to communicate with wolves, which he has felt since season one, is an essential part of his identity. He is a “wolfman,” connected to animals, and Ishamael plans to use his power in his army. Meanwhile, Mat is released from prison by Liandrin, but this is just a ploy to get him closer to Ishamael, who plans to use him against Rand. Min, a psychic, predicts that Mat will kill Rand, making him a valuable target for Ishamael. Mat escapes with Min, but is soon kidnapped by Ishamael, who tries to manipulate him through visions that exploit his insecurities. However, Mat demonstrates surprising cunning, reminding viewers why his character is so important.

Elayne, Nynaeve, and Egwene: A Strengthened Friendship?

The friendship between Elayne, Nynaeve, and Egwene is one of the central points of the second season. When Liandrin kidnaps them and hands them over to the Seanchan, these three women show how much they are willing to fight for each other. Even in desperate situations, they remain loyal. Egwene, in particular, faces a cruel twist when she is transformed into Damane by the Seanchan. A Damane is a woman with the power to channel who is enslaved with a collar, controlled by her Sul’dam. However, Egwene discovers a way to turn the tables, realizing that the Sul’dam also has weak channeling abilities and can therefore be controlled by Damane’s collar. She uses this discovery to reverse roles and force her captor, Renna, to submit to her.

The Final Battle Between Rand and Ishamael?

The highly anticipated final battle of The Wheel of Time between Rand and Ishamael is the climax of the second season. Lanfear, an enigmatic figure who initially infiltrated Selene, reveals her loyalty to Rand, causing surprise among viewers. She leaves Rand at the Tower to rescue Egwene and confronts Ishamael, claiming that Rand will join the Dark One’s cause. However, this is a bluff, and Ishamael knows it. Ishamael attempts to orchestrate Rand’s death to manipulate him into a future life, but Mat’s intervention and Egwene’s determination turn the tide of the battle. Mat, remembering his past life as a warrior, helps Rand, although he accidentally hurts him due to an illusion created by Ishamael. However, Egwene demonstrates her strength by temporarily facing Ishamael. With the help of Moiraine, who deactivates the Damane, Rand finally stabs Ishamael with his Crane-marked sword, fulfilling the object’s destiny.

Does Rand Manage to Save Himself?

With seemingly everything against her, Egwene rejoins and protects her friends. They are joined by Perrin, Nynaeve, and Elayne, who manages to heal Rand. It is worth pointing out that Moiraine also helps them, as she uses her waves to free the Dragon from its shield. In this way, Rand has enough power to kill Ishamael, who claims that he “sees nothing at all” when he is dying. Just as the prophecy states, Rand is proclaimed as the Dragon Reborn, with Moiraine creating a fiery dragon to symbolize his return. Everyone in town cheers!

What Happened to the rest of the Forsaken?

While Lanfear planned to place the Forsaken at the bottom of the ocean, Ishamael freed them before his death. To her disappointment, Moghedien is in charge of telling her. The latter warns that she already has plans for Rand and the friends of Two Rivers, showing that she will become one of the main villains of the following season. The production culminates with Lanfear saying, “May the Light help you, Rand al’Thor.” We just have to find out if he can protect it.
